You have forgotten to buy something and turn around to return to the shopping area. Was it appropriate to use the roundabout in order to turn around?

It is a myth that you are only permitted to drive a certain amount of circuits of a roundabout. The law does not regulate the number of circuits – what the law does prohibit is unnecessary driving or driving that is disruptive to traffic. In this example, you have good reason to complete a whole circuit, which means that it is permitted.

A roundabout is a good place at which to turn around, because you avoid having to stop at a junction and reversing around a corner, or performing some similar manoeuvre.

Am I permitted to make 3 circuits of the roundabout?
– It depends on whether or not you have a good reason to do so. A good reason could be that your GPS is not working properly, or if you are not able to change to the right-hand lane in a safe manner.
